oracle中的一些自己不常用的命令:
1.oradmin:用于手工进行oracle服务的创建,修改,删除等操作。
例如:创建一个服务,实例会随之启动
C:\>oradim -new -sid nw
2.orapwd:通过此命令可以重建口令文件。
C:\>orapwd
Usage: orapwd file= password= entries=
3.emca:手工配置DBControl
创建:emca -repos create
详细日志保存在$ORACLE_HOME/cfgtoollogs/emca
启动:emctl start dbconsole
停止:emctl stop dbconsole
如果配置了EM资料库
emca -config dbcontrol db -repos recreate
4.SQL执行是产生执行计划
1.SQL>set autotrace on/off
打开关闭执行计划
2.SQL>set autot traceonly
显示SQL影响的行数,执行计划,执行的统计信息和不输出结果集
3.SQL>set autot on exp
输出执行后的结果集及执行计划
4.命令概要:
set autot {off|on|trace[only]} [exp[lain]] [stat[istics]]
5.explain plan
用途:可以解释使用文本常量的SQL,也可对绑定变量的SQL进行解释
例如:
explain pan [set statement_id = &item_id] for &sql;
select * from table(dbms_xplan.display);
1.oradmin:用于手工进行oracle服务的创建,修改,删除等操作。
例如:创建一个服务,实例会随之启动
C:\>oradim -new -sid nw
2.orapwd:通过此命令可以重建口令文件。
C:\>orapwd
Usage: orapwd file= password= entries=
3.emca:手工配置DBControl
创建:emca -repos create
详细日志保存在$ORACLE_HOME/cfgtoollogs/emca
启动:emctl start dbconsole
停止:emctl stop dbconsole
如果配置了EM资料库
emca -config dbcontrol db -repos recreate
4.SQL执行是产生执行计划
1.SQL>set autotrace on/off
打开关闭执行计划
2.SQL>set autot traceonly
显示SQL影响的行数,执行计划,执行的统计信息和不输出结果集
3.SQL>set autot on exp
输出执行后的结果集及执行计划
4.命令概要:
set autot {off|on|trace[only]} [exp[lain]] [stat[istics]]
5.explain plan
用途:可以解释使用文本常量的SQL,也可对绑定变量的SQL进行解释
例如:
explain pan [set statement_id = &item_id] for &sql;
select * from table(dbms_xplan.display);
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/10710960/viewspace-368909/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/10710960/viewspace-368909/